Understanding Harmonicode Sports
Harmonicode Sports is a data-driven sports analytics platform that uses AI, motion capture, and biomechanics to analyze an athlete’s movement, efficiency, and overall performance. This technology is particularly beneficial in sports such as football, basketball, tennis, track and field, and even esports, where precision and reaction time can determine the difference between victory and defeat.
The platform integrates advanced machine learning algorithms to track an athlete’s form, detect inefficiencies, and provide real-time feedback. It works by capturing movement through high-speed cameras and sensors, processing the data through AI models, and generating actionable insights that help athletes optimize their techniques.
Key Features of Harmonicode Sports
1. AI-Powered Motion Analysis
One of the standout features of Sports Harmonicode is its AI-powered motion analysis system. By using computer vision and deep learning, the system tracks an athlete’s movements with extreme precision. It can identify biomechanical inefficiencies, suggest corrections, and compare an athlete’s form to that of professional athletes. This allows players and coaches to make data-backed decisions that improve efficiency, speed, and agility.
2. Real-Time Performance Tracking
Athletes and coaches often rely on traditional methods such as video replays to analyze performance. However, Harmonicode Sports takes it a step further by providing real-time tracking of speed, acceleration, reaction time, and muscle engagement. With the use of wearable sensors and AI-powered analysis, the platform offers instant feedback, allowing athletes to make quick adjustments during training sessions.
3. Personalized Training Programs
Harmonicode Sports leverages machine learning models to create customized training programs based on an athlete’s strengths, weaknesses, and overall performance metrics. These training plans focus on injury prevention, endurance building, and skill enhancement, providing tailored workouts to ensure continuous improvement.
4. Injury Prevention and Rehabilitation
One of the biggest challenges in sports is the risk of injury. Harmonicode Sports helps reduce this risk by detecting movement patterns that may lead to potential injuries. By analyzing an athlete’s biomechanics, the system can recommend adjustments to minimize stress on muscles and joints. Additionally, for injured athletes, the platform assists in rehabilitation by monitoring recovery progress and providing structured exercise routines to regain strength safely.
